Debian Node.js日志中第三方库调用问题分析
在Debian系统中,Node.js应用程序的日志可能包含有关第三方库调用的信息。要分析这些日志,您需要首先找到日志文件,然后使用文本编辑器或日志分析工具查看和分析它们。以下是一些建议的步骤:
-
定位日志文件:Node.js应用程序的日志文件通常位于应用程序的工作目录中,或者在您在启动应用程序时指定的目录中。日志文件可能具有
.log扩展名,或者可能是标准输出(stdout)或标准错误(stderr)。 -
使用文本编辑器查看日志:您可以使用任何文本编辑器(如vim、nano或gedit)打开和查看日志文件。在Debian系统中,您可以使用以下命令安装文本编辑器:
sudo apt-get install vim nano gedit -
分析日志:在日志文件中,您可以查找与第三方库调用相关的信息。这些信息可能包括函数名、参数值、错误消息等。您可以使用文本搜索工具(如grep)来搜索特定的关键字或模式。例如,要在日志文件中搜索名为
someFunction的函数调用,您可以使用以下命令:grep 'someFunction' logfile.log -
使用日志分析工具:如果您需要更高级的日志分析功能,可以考虑使用专门的日志分析工具,如ELK Stack(Elasticsearch、Logstash和Kibana)或Graylog。这些工具可以帮助您更轻松地搜索、过滤和分析日志数据,并提供可视化界面以便更好地理解日志中的信息。
-
调试第三方库调用:如果您在日志中发现问题或错误,可能需要调试第三方库。您可以使用Node.js的内置调试器或第三方调试工具(如ndb或node-inspector)来调试应用程序。要启动调试器,您可以在启动命令中添加
--inspect或--inspect-brk标志。例如:node --inspect-brk app.js然后,您可以使用Chrome DevTools或其他支持Node.js调试的工具连接到调试器并逐步执行代码以查找问题。
通过遵循这些步骤,您应该能够分析Debian系统中Node.js应用程序的日志并解决与第三方库调用相关的问题。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Debian Node.js日志中第三方库调用问题分析
本文地址: https://pptw.com/jishu/775453.html
